九江市网站建设_网站建设公司_服务器维护_seo优化
2026/1/9 10:37:48 网站建设 项目流程

如何利用AFFiNE构建高效的多语言协作环境

【免费下载链接】AFFiNEAFFiNE 是一个开源、一体化的工作区和操作系统,适用于组装您的知识库等的所有构建块 - 维基、知识管理、演示和数字资产。它是 Notion 和 Miro 的更好替代品。项目地址: https://gitcode.com/GitHub_Trending/af/AFFiNE

在全球数字化协作日益频繁的今天,语言差异成为跨国团队面临的主要挑战。AFFiNE作为开源的一体化工作空间,通过其强大的国际化功能,为团队提供了打破语言壁垒的解决方案。该项目支持25种语言,包括英语、中文、日语、韩语、法语、德语、西班牙语等主流语言,让不同文化背景的团队成员能够在统一平台上实现无缝协作。

多语言协作的核心挑战

语言界面适配难题跨国团队成员往往使用不同的母语界面,传统协作工具难以满足个性化需求。AFFiNE通过动态语言切换系统,让每位成员都能使用自己熟悉的语言界面进行工作,大大降低了学习成本。

内容翻译与同步问题文档内容需要频繁在不同语言间转换,手动翻译效率低下且容易出错。AFFiNE集成了AI翻译功能,能够智能提供翻译建议,并维护术语的一致性。

文化差异处理不同地区在日期格式、数字表示等方面存在差异,直接复制容易造成误解。AFFiNE提供完整的本地化支持,包括时间格式化、数字和货币格式适配等。

AFFiNE国际化技术架构

模块化翻译系统AFFiNE采用i18next框架构建多语言支持,所有翻译资源存储在预编译的语言文件中。系统通过自动生成的类型定义确保翻译准确性,开发者可以轻松扩展新的语言支持。

实时语言切换机制用户无需刷新页面即可切换界面语言,所有界面元素会立即更新。这种设计确保了用户体验的流畅性,同时保持当前编辑内容不丢失。

资源管理优化

  • 按需加载语言包,减少初始加载时间
  • 智能缓存机制避免重复下载
  • 预编译优化提升系统响应速度

实施路径与最佳实践

环境搭建步骤

git clone https://gitcode.com/GitHub_Trending/af/AFFiNE cd AFFiNE yarn install yarn dev

核心配置模块翻译配置文件位于packages/frontend/i18n/src/i18n.gen.ts,该文件包含了所有界面元素的翻译键和类型定义。

扩展功能集成AFFiNE支持从右到左语言布局,能够自动适配阿拉伯语、希伯来语等特殊语言需求。

进阶协作技巧

团队翻译工作流建立统一的翻译标准至关重要。AFFiNE提供了翻译进度追踪和质量检测工具,确保翻译工作的规范性和一致性。

跨平台同步策略用户的语言设置会在Web端、桌面应用和移动端之间自动同步,确保在任何设备上都能获得一致的使用体验。

性能优化建议

  • 定期清理未使用的语言包
  • 合理配置缓存策略
  • 监控翻译文件加载性能

成功案例与经验分享

多家跨国企业通过部署AFFiNE多语言协作平台,成功实现了:

  • 跨时区文档协作效率提升
  • 多语言内容管理规范化
  • 团队知识库建设统一化

实施建议

  • 从核心团队开始试点
  • 建立定期审查机制
  • 收集用户反馈持续优化

通过AFFiNE的多语言协作功能,团队能够真正实现无国界的工作环境,让语言不再成为协作的障碍。

【免费下载链接】AFFiNEAFFiNE 是一个开源、一体化的工作区和操作系统,适用于组装您的知识库等的所有构建块 - 维基、知识管理、演示和数字资产。它是 Notion 和 Miro 的更好替代品。项目地址: https://gitcode.com/GitHub_Trending/af/AFFiNE

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询